Familiarizing yourself with common legal terms can help clarify the claims process. Understanding definitions related to liability, damages, negligence, and insurance policies empowers you to engage more confidently with your legal representation and insurance providers.
Liability refers to the legal responsibility one party has for causing harm or damage in an accident. Determining liability is key in rideshare cases to establish who must compensate the injured parties.
Negligence is the failure to exercise reasonable care, leading to an accident or injury. Proving negligence in a rideshare accident involves showing that the driver or another party did not act responsibly.
Damages are the monetary compensation awarded to an injured party for losses suffered, including medical expenses, lost wages, pain and suffering, and property damage.
Insurance coverage refers to the protection provided by insurance policies that pay for damages or injuries resulting from an accident. In rideshare cases, both the driver’s personal insurance and the company’s commercial policy may apply.

Immediately following a rideshare accident, ensure your safety and seek medical attention if needed. It is important to document the scene, gather contact information from all parties involved, and notify the rideshare company about the incident. Prompt action can help preserve important evidence and support your claim later. In California, the statute of limitations for personal injury claims, including those from rideshare accidents, is generally two years from the date of the accident. It is important to act promptly, as delays can jeopardize your ability to file a claim. Yes, rideshare companies are required to provide liability insurance coverage for their drivers while they are logged into the app and transporting passengers. Coverage limits and conditions vary depending on whether the driver is waiting for a ride request, en route to pick up a passenger, or actively transporting. If the driver lacks sufficient insurance coverage, you may be able to seek compensation through your own uninsured/underinsured motorist insurance policy if you have one. Additionally, legal options may exist to pursue damages through other parties involved. A legal professional can help explore all available avenues to recover your losses.
